comparemela.com
Home
Andalusia Midland Scientific
Top Locations Tagged with Andalusia Midland Scientific
Andalusia Midland Scientific in United States - 61232/Supermarket near Rock Island
1). Midland Scientific Inc, Andalusia, IL
vimarsana © 2020. All Rights Reserved.